Cost of adding on

An addition floor can be a great way to increase your living space when remodeling a house. The cost for a second-floor addition can range from $100 to $500/square foot depending on the space and its size. A ranch house with a second floor would cost $46,000 to add. An average addition cost is between $100 and $300 per sq. foot. You can add up to 800 square feet.

Cost of upgrading electrical wiring

Upgrades to electrical wiring can be costly, whether you are remodeling your house or adding new appliances. This task can be costly and disruptive, regardless of whether you have to replace the entire wiring or add additional circuits. The contractor will take down walls and get to the wiring in order to complete the task. You can save money by avoiding certain steps.

For a simple job like replacing an electrical panel, it will cost between $1,500-$2,500. To upgrade the panel, you'll need to install a new one that has a higher amperage rating, which will cost about $500 to $2,500. Some electrical contractors are able to clean up after themselves. Hiring a cleaning crew to clean up the site can run about $500, depending on the scope of the job.

  • Most lenders will lend you up to 75% or 80% of the appraised value of your home, but some will go higher. (kiplinger.com)
  • According to the National Association of the Remodeling Industry's 2019 remodeling impact report , realtors estimate that homeowners can recover 59% of the cost of a complete kitchen renovation if they sell their home. (bhg.com)
  • Rather, allot 10% to 15% for a contingency fund to pay for unexpected construction issues. (kiplinger.com)
  • It is advisable, however, to have a contingency of 10–20 per cent to allow for the unexpected expenses that can arise when renovating older homes. (realhomes.com)
  • A final payment of, say, 5% to 10% will be due when the space is livable and usable (your contract probably will say "substantial completion"). (kiplinger.com)
